Comprehensive Tracking Features

The functionality of this addon goes far beyond simple logging. Here is what you can expect when you integrate it into your user interface:

  • State Tracking: Records timestamps for when a quest is newly discovered, accepted, completed, or abandoned.
  • Dialogue Preservation: Automatically saves introduction, description, in-progress, and completion dialogs, including multiple variations for daily or repeatable quests.
  • Reward Analysis: Tracks specific hand-in items, currency amounts, and profession skill gains.
  • Reputation Monitoring: Predicts reputation gains upon discovery and verifies them against actual gains after turning in the quest.
  • Search and Sort: Allows you to order your log by quest ID, name, state, or timestamp, with robust search capabilities.

Even if you have completed quests before installing the addon, QuestKeeper can partially import data for those entries using the game API, allowing you to manually edit and flesh out the records later. While properly tracked quests are locked to preserve data integrity, imported entries offer flexibility for completionists looking to fill gaps in their history.

Future Developments and Known Issues

No software is perfect at launch, and the developers are transparent about current limitations. Some users may notice that currency amounts are not yet fully tracked, or that text formatting can be tricky when editing imported quests manually. Additionally, there are rare instances where actual reputation values might not immediately overwrite predicted ones. These issues are actively being addressed through community feedback and ticket submissions.

Looking ahead, the roadmap includes exciting features such as independent tracking for separate characters with an option to combine data into a unified database. Future updates aim to track which specific characters have completed certain quests, ensure correct character names appear in dialogue texts, and even capture conversations that occur during cutscenes. There are also plans to log quest giver names and precise task locations, making this the definitive archive for WoW historians.
